Start your trip in Guwahati, Assam. In the morning, visit the Kamakhya Temple, a famous Hindu pilgrimage site dedicated to the goddess Kamakhya. Explore the unique architectural style and enjoy panoramic views of the city. In the afternoon, take a boat ride on the Brahmaputra River and witness the mesmerizing sunset. In the evening, head to Fancy Bazaar, a bustling market where you can shop for traditional handicrafts and local produce.
Travel to Shillong, the capital of Meghalaya. Start your morning by visiting Elephant Falls, a stunning three-tiered waterfall surrounded by lush greenery. In the afternoon, explore the Mawphlang Sacred Forest, a biodiverse forest known for its ancient sacred groves and unique flora. In the evening, explore Police Bazar, the main commercial hub of Shillong, where you can shop for local handicrafts and try traditional cuisine.
Embark on a wildlife adventure at Kaziranga National Park. In the morning, go for an exciting jeep safari to spot the iconic one-horned rhinoceros and other wildlife species. Afterward, visit the Kaziranga Orchid and Biodiversity Park to admire the diverse array of orchids and learn about their conservation. In the evening, enjoy a cultural dance performance showcasing Assamese traditions.
Head to Tawang, a beautiful town nestled in the Himalayas. Start your day by visiting the Tawang Monastery, the largest Buddhist monastery in India. Explore the serene surroundings and soak in the spiritual atmosphere. In the afternoon, hike to the stunning P.T. Tso Lake, also known as the Madhuri Lake, and enjoy the breathtaking views. In the evening, visit the local market to shop for traditional handicrafts.
Take a ferry to Majuli Island, the world's largest river island. In the morning, visit the Satras, ancient monastic institutions where you can witness traditional dance and music performances. Explore the vibrant culture and interact with the locals. In the afternoon, take a bicycle tour around the island and admire the scenic beauty of the countryside. In the evening, enjoy a sunset boat ride on the Brahmaputra River.
Travel to the enchanting Dzukou Valley located in Nagaland. In the morning, embark on a trek through the picturesque valley, surrounded by rolling hills and colorful flowers. Enjoy a picnic amidst nature and breathe in the fresh mountain air. In the afternoon, visit Japfu Peak, the highest peak in Nagaland, for panoramic views of the valley. In the evening, camp overnight in the valley for a memorable experience.
Head to Cherrapunji, known as the wettest place on earth. Start your day by visiting the Nohkalikai Falls, one of the tallest waterfalls in India, cascading down from a lush green cliff. In the afternoon, explore the Living Root Bridges, a unique natural phenomenon where tree roots are trained to form bridges. In the evening, visit the Mawsmai Caves, a network of limestone caves with unique formations.
For nature lovers, don't miss the Umiam Lake near Shillong, a serene lake surrounded by hills and perfect for boating. In Tawang, explore the Bumla Pass, a high-altitude mountain pass offering breathtaking views of the snow-clad peaks. In Nagaland, visit the Khonoma Village, known for its eco-tourism initiatives and rich Naga heritage.
